High prices of corn grains due to their shortage in some regions force researcher to explore nonc... more High prices of corn grains due to their shortage in some regions force researcher to explore nonconventional alternatives. Therefore, the present study aimed to evaluate the effect of replacing corn grains at 25% (dry matter (DM) basis) with date press cake (DPC) without/with exogenous enzymes at 2 L/ton feed in diets of Barki sheep (24 rams divided as 6 rams/treatment) and Egyptian buffaloes (16 buffaloes divided as 4 buffalo/treatment). Each experiment was conducted under 4 treatments regime: control diet containing only corn grains, T1 diet where the control diet supplemented with exogenous enzyme, T2 diet where the control diet contained DPC on corn replacement (25% DM basis), and T3 diet where the control diet contained DPC on corn replacement (25% DM basis) along with exogenous enzyme supplement. The control diet contained concentrate feed mixture, corn silage, and rice straw at 50:40:10, respectively. Data on nutrient intake, digestibility, and nitrogen balance in sheep, as well as on blood parameters, milk production, and composition in buffaloes, were analyzed using the PROC GLM/MIXED procedure of SAS. The sheep under T2 and T3 treatments demonstrated greater digestibility of dry matter, organic matter, and neutral detergent fibers, along with improved nitrogen balance. The milk yield and its constituents were improved in the buffaloes under T3 treatment followed by those buffaloes under T2 and T1 treatments. This investigation could conclude that replacing corn grains with DPC at 25% (DM basis) in ruminant diets had beneficial effects on nutrients digestibility and milk yield along with its composition.
SUMMARY Six crossbred sheep (32.00±0.603 kg body weight (BW)) and 6 Baladi goats (18.00±0.703 kg ... more SUMMARY Six crossbred sheep (32.00±0.603 kg body weight (BW)) and 6 Baladi goats (18.00±0.703 kg BW) were used in 2 × 2 factorial design to evaluate the effect of exogenous enzymes of ZADO ® ( i.e., ENZ) and on nutrients digestibility and growth performance. Animals were fed on wheat straw ad libitum and restricted amount of commercial concentrate with (+ENZ) or without (-ENZ) 10 g/animal/day of ZADO ® to cover 120% of their maintenance requirements. Nutrients digestibilities were increased (P<0.01) in +ENZ groups and it was better in goats than sheep. Goats had the lowest total dry matter intake (DMI) that associated with an increased in digestibility and average daily gain (ADG) more than sheep. Feed efficiency, metabolizable protein intake and net energy for growth occurred sheep and goats diets of +ENZ and the highest (P<0.01) values were observed in goats received +ENZ diet. The nutritive value of rice straw (RS) and Pleurotus ostreatus spent rice straw (SRS) was studied... more The nutritive value of rice straw (RS) and Pleurotus ostreatus spent rice straw (SRS) was studied by analyzing its proximate composition, fiber fractions, in vitro digestibility, amino acids content and scanning electron microscopy (SEM). The possibility of replacing berseem clover (BC; Trifolium alexandrinum) with SRS at different levels also was studied. Results showed higher protein content for SRS compared to RS (3.4 to 11.7%) while, DM, OM, NFE, CF, NDF, ADF, ADL, hemicellulose and cellulose were less for SRS than for RS. Highest concentration of amino acids (mg/100 g) was in SRS compared to RS. The SEM showed an extensive damage of SRS when compared to RS. Data also showed that SRS had higher in vitro dry matter disappearance (DMD) and in vitro organic matter disappearance (OMD) compared to RS. The objective of this study was to determine the effect of exogenous enzymes (ENZ) on nutrient pr... more The objective of this study was to determine the effect of exogenous enzymes (ENZ) on nutrient profile and ruminal degradability of rice straw (RS), distillers dried grains with solubles (DDGS) and their mixture (RS with 10% DDGS). Ten samples of each fibrous feed were mixed with ZAD® (mixture of cellulases, xylanaxes, proteases and alpha amylase). ENZ was added at 0, 1 and 3 L to one ton of the fibrous feeds and the mixture was ensiled for 30 days. Feed samples were incubated for 72 h in rumen liquor of sheep to determine the degradability of DM, NDF and ADF. Pretreatment of feeds and their mixture (RS and DDGS) with ENZ at 3 L were increased (P<0.01) the degradation of NDF and ADF. Degradation fractions (a, b, (a+b) and c) of feeds were improved (P<0.01) at 3 L of ENZ, except the c of NDF and ADF of RS which were not affected by ENZ treatment.
